Weingut Tement's Sausaler Sauvignon Blanc is a masterclass in the expression of slate terroir. While the estate is famous for its limestone-rich soils in Berghausen, this village wine (Ortswein) hails from the historic Sausal region, home to some of the highest and steepest vineyards in Austria, reaching elevations of up to 600 meters. Here, the vines dig deep into ancient Paleozoic red and grey slate soils. This unique geological foundation, combined with dramatic diurnal temperature shifts, imparts a distinctively cool, flinty, and crystalline character to the wine. Spontaneously fermented and aged on its fine lees, it captures the wild, herbal essence of the Styrian highlands, offering a tense, mineral-driven alternative to the estate's limestone-grown classics.

Established in 1959 in the picturesque hills of Southern Styria, Austria, Weingut Tement is a family-run estate globally renowned for defining the modern standard of Austrian Sauvignon Blanc. Now managed by the third generation, Armin and Stefan Tement, the winery is situated on the steep, limestone-rich slopes of the legendary Zieregg vineyard. Operating under strict biodynamic principles, the estate focuses on minimal intervention, spontaneous fermentation, and extended lees aging in neutral oak casks to preserve the intense minerality of their terroir. Their signature single-vineyard wines, particularly the iconic Ried Zieregg Sauvignon Blanc and Ried Grassnitzberg, showcase an unparalleled tension and longevity that have cemented Tement's reputation as one of Austria's premier wine estates.
